Cet article présente principalement la conception du module du framework thinkPHP5.0, décrit brièvement la structure des répertoires et la convention de dénomination de thinkPHP5.0, et analyse les principes et les méthodes d'accès à la bibliothèque de classes de module sous forme d'exemples. reportez-vous aux exemples de cet article. Décrit la conception du module du framework thinkPHP5.0. Partagez-le avec tout le monde pour votre référence. Les détails sont les suivants : La version 5.0 a une conception flexible pour la fonction du module. Elle adopte une architecture multi-module par défaut et prend en charge une conception de module unique. Les espaces de noms de tous les modules utilisent l'application. comme espace de noms racine (peut être configuré et modifié). Structure du répertoire La structure standard du répertoire des applications et des modules est la suivante : ├─application Répertoire des applications (peut être défini) │ ├─common &nb
1 Conception détaillée du module de framework thinkPHP5.0
Introduction : Cet article présente principalement la conception du module du framework thinkPHP5.0, décrit brièvement la structure du répertoire thinkPHP5.0 et la convention de dénomination, et analyse les principes et les méthodes d'accès de la bibliothèque de classes de module sous forme d'exemples. Amis dans le besoin Vous pouvez vous référer à ce qui suit
2 Technologie de mise en cache de données PHP des données de la finale 2009nba
Introduction : Données des finales 2009nba : données des finales 2009nba Technologie de mise en cache des données PHP : la mise en cache des données est une méthode d'optimisation des performances couramment utilisée dans le développement Web. À l'heure actuelle, il existe deux formes principales de mise en cache de fichiers ou de mise en cache de bases de données. La mise en cache de bases de données n'est pas impossible, et elle est en effet très bonne et importante. Je pense que les bases de données traditionnelles sont principalement prises en compte à partir de la couche métier, de la conception des modules, etc., tandis que les bases de données de cache sont principalement conçues à partir de la couche d'implémentation, principalement pour mettre en cache les requêtes multi-tables couramment utilisées. L'essentiel ici est la mise en cache des fichiers. Il existe de nombreuses informations sur Internet. J'ai reproduit ici quelques informations principales. Le cache est un mode d'application typique de la stratégie « d'échange d'espace contre du temps », qui est un moyen d'améliorer l'efficacité de la conception
3 bbs.5isotoi5.org basée sur. mysql (4)
Introduction : bbs.5isotoi5.org:bbs.5isotoi5.org Conception BBS basée sur mysql (4) : 5. Conception du module de mise en page La soi-disant classification est davantage destinée au serveur telnet. En mode cq66, les utilisateurs peuvent classer selon leurs propres souhaits. Quoi qu'il en soit, en fin de compte, ils sont accessibles directement avec la carte comme unité de base. Pour accéder aux articles de mise en page, l'article entier est utilisé comme paramètre lors du stockage, et le découpage de l'article est complété par cette couche. Si la couche supérieure le transmet en unités de blocs, toute la transmission est effectuée dans la couche supérieure. et après combinaison, les paramètres sont transmis à cette couche pour décomposition ; lors de la lecture, cette couche est accessible par blocs. Si la couche supérieure souhaite être accessible en unités de texte intégral, le travail de fusion est effectué dans cette couche supérieure.
4. est basé sur la conception BBS du tutoriel mysql (4)_PHP
Introduction : conception BBS basée sur mysql (4). 5. La soi-disant classification de la conception des modules de mise en page est davantage destinée au serveur telnet. En mode cq66, les utilisateurs peuvent classer selon leurs propres souhaits. Quoi qu'il en soit, en fin de compte, elle est directement basée sur la mise en page
5. Conception BBS basée sur mysql (3)_PHP tutoriel
Introduction : Conception BBS basée sur mysql (3). 4. Conception du module utilisateur Pour la base de données sous-jacente, la fonction API C de mysql est appelée pour modifier la base de données, et certaines variables d'état (telles que les noms d'utilisateur) sont stockées en interne, qui doivent être laissées à la couche supérieure pour être complétées
6 . Conception BBS basée sur mysql 3_PHP Tutoriel
Introduction : conception bbs basée sur mysql 3. 4. Conception du module utilisateur Pour le base de données sous-jacente, l'appel C des fonctions API mysql est utilisé pour modifier la base de données, et certaines variables d'état (telles que les noms d'utilisateur) sont stockées en interne, qui doivent être laissées à la couche supérieure pour être complétées
7. 1 expérience en développement d'API avec PHP
Introduction : Une certaine expérience du développement d'API avec PHP. Cet article est mon expérience personnelle après avoir développé moi-même certaines interfaces d'application et lu certains documents. 1. La conception du module fonctionnel extrait les fonctions correspondantes de l'analyse de la demande. Cette partie est directement liée aux fonctions que nos programmeurs doivent implémenter pour cette application. Par exemple : inscription et connexion. 2. Conception de l'architecture de l'application Pour l'ensemble de l'application, notre architecture est en mode C/S. Le client utilise Android et IOS et le serveur utilise un langage de développement côté serveur pour fournir
8 Conception BBS basée sur MySQL 3
<.>Introduction : conception BBS basée sur mysql 3. 4. Conception du module utilisateur Pour la base de données sous-jacente, la fonction API C de mysql est appelée pour modifier la base de données, et certaines variables d'état (telles que les noms d'utilisateur) sont stockées en interne, ce qui est laissé à la couche supérieure pour compléter
9 . Conception BBS basée sur mysql (3)
Introduction : ec(2); 4. Conception du module utilisateur Pour la base de données sous-jacente, la fonction API C de mysql est appelée pour modifier la base de données, et certaines variables d'état sont enregistrées en interne (comme le nom d'utilisateur, ou doit-il être laissé à la couche supérieure ?). , la gestion des utilisateurs est fournie. Class UserManage { private: char myuserid[20]; // Identifiant de l'utilisateur, vide avant la connexion à l'heure de connexion //
Introduction : ylbtech-DatabaseDesgin:ylbtech-Model-Account (Conception du module de compte universel) ylbtech-Model-Account (Conception du module de compte universel) 1.A, diagramme de base de données 1.B, script de conception de base de données -- ============ ============ ===================== -- Utilisateur
【Questions et réponses recommandées connexes] :
php - Conception du module Laravel Log
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!